The 2023 Womex Award winners bring their afro-psychedelic future pop from Soweto to BrightonBCUC: Bantu Continua Uhuru Consciousness bring their mix of indigenous funk, hip-hop consciousness and punk rock energy from Soweto, South Africa.
A stone’s throw from the church where Desmond Tutu organised the escape of the most wanted anti-Apartheid activists of Soweto, BCUC rehearse in a shipping container-turned community restaurant, where their indomitable outspokenness echoes in a whole new way.Like its elders, Bantu Continua Uhuru Consciousness sees its music as a hedonistic trance, but also as a weapon of political and spiritual liberation.
The seven-piece band has been mesmerising audiences both locally and globally with its indigenous funk and high-energy performances that have fast made it one of South Africa’s most successful musical exports.
